Arranging new lead-coloured wings and bodywork for a Barker Torpedo, chassis 98-NK.

Identifier  ExFiles\Box 73\1\  scan0037
Date  6th June 1924
  
X. 9840
To HS.{Lord Ernest Hives - Chair} from DA{Bernard Day - Chassis Design}/EV.{Ivan Evernden - coachwork}
DA{Bernard Day - Chassis Design}/EV{Ivan Evernden - coachwork}1/M6.6.24.
RE. BARKER TORPEDO - CHASSIS 98-NK (LK.{L. King})
We have heard from Messrs. Parkers to the effect that as this is a special case they can provide a set of new wings for the above car, finished in lead colour, in 5 to 7 days, and will go over the body at the same time. As we shall be on holidays would you communicate with Barkers direct if you wish to have anything done in the matter.
DA{Bernard Day - Chassis Design}/EV.{Ivan Evernden - coachwork}
